What is the primary purpose of Power Query Editor?

To store large datasets efficiently

To create visual reports from data

The primary purpose of Power Query Editor is to transform and prepare data.

To automate data entry processes

Answer explanation

The primary purpose of Power Query Editor is to transform and prepare data, allowing users to clean, reshape, and combine data from various sources before analysis or reporting.

What is the function of the 'Merge Queries' feature in Power Query?

To create a new table from existing data.

To combine data from multiple tables based on a related column.

To filter data from a single table.

To visualize data in charts and graphs.

Answer explanation

The 'Merge Queries' feature in Power Query is used to combine data from multiple tables based on a related column, allowing for more comprehensive data analysis and integration.

Which DAX function is used to calculate the sum of a column?

AVERAGE

MAX

SUM

COUNT

Answer explanation

The SUM function in DAX is specifically designed to calculate the total of a column's values. Other options like AVERAGE, MAX, and COUNT serve different purposes, making SUM the correct choice for summing a column.

Which visualization type is best for showing trends over time?

Bar chart

Pie chart

Scatter plot

Line chart

Answer explanation

A line chart is best for showing trends over time as it effectively displays data points connected by lines, making it easy to visualize changes and patterns over a continuous time interval.
